Конвертируйте STL в DOCX в .NET с помощью GroupDocs.Conversion: подробное руководство
Введение
В современном мире, где все основано на данных, возможность бесшовного преобразования файлов между различными форматами имеет решающее значение. Независимо от того, являетесь ли вы инженером, которому нужно обмениваться 3D-моделями, или бизнес-профессионалом, стремящимся оптимизировать документооборот, преобразование файлов STL в DOCX может стать преобразующим. Это руководство проведет вас через использование мощного GroupDocs.Конвертация для .NET библиотека для легкого выполнения этого преобразования.
Что вы узнаете:
- Настройка среды для GroupDocs.Conversion
- Пошаговые инструкции по загрузке и конвертации файлов STL в DOCX
- Лучшие практики и советы по устранению неполадок при конвертации файлов
Давайте начнем с обсуждения предварительных условий, необходимых для начала работы.
Предпосылки
Прежде чем погрузиться в GroupDocs.Конверсия, убедитесь, что у вас есть:
- The .NET Framework В вашей системе установлена версия 4.5 или более поздняя.
- Базовые знания сред разработки C# и .NET, таких как Visual Studio.
- Библиотека GroupDocs.Conversion для .NET легко добавляется через диспетчер пакетов NuGet.
Выполнив эти предварительные условия, вы готовы настроить GroupDocs.Conversion для .NET.
Настройка GroupDocs.Conversion для .NET
Начало работы с GroupDocs.Конверсия просто. Вы можете установить эту мощную библиотеку с помощью:
Консоль диспетчера пакетов NuGet
Install-Package GroupDocs.Conversion -Version 25.3.0
.NET CLI
dotnet add package GroupDocs.Conversion --version 25.3.0
Этапы получения лицензии
Чтобы изучить все функции, рассмотрите возможность получения временной или полной лицензии:
- Бесплатная пробная версия: Проверьте возможности библиотеки с помощью собственных файлов.
- Временная лицензия: Используйте его в течение длительного периода оценки.
- Покупка: Для долгосрочного использования и поддержки.
После установки инициализируйте GroupDocs.Conversion в вашем проекте C# следующим образом:
using GroupDocs.Conversion;
Руководство по внедрению
В этом разделе мы рассмотрим, как конвертировать файлы STL в формат DOCX с помощью GroupDocs.КонверсияДавайте разберем это шаг за шагом.
Загрузка и конвертация STL в DOCX
Обзор
Эта функция позволяет легко загружать файл STL и преобразовывать его в документ DOCX, что упрощает редактирование и распространение текстового контента, полученного из 3D-моделей.
Шаг 1: Определите пути к файлам
Убедитесь, что пути к каталогам настроены правильно. Замените заполнители фактическими путями:
string documentDirectory = @"YOUR_DOCUMENT_DIRECTORY";
string outputDirectory = @"YOUR_OUTPUT_DIRECTORY";
if (!Directory.Exists(documentDirectory))
Directory.CreateDirectory(documentDirectory);
if (!Directory.Exists(outputDirectory))
Directory.CreateDirectory(outputDirectory);
string inputFilePath = Path.Combine(documentDirectory, "sample.stl");
string outputFilePath = Path.Combine(outputDirectory, "stl-converted-to.docx");
Шаг 2: Инициализация конвертера и настройка параметров
Загрузите ваш STL-файл с помощью Converter
класс и настройте параметры преобразования:
using (var converter = new Converter(inputFilePath))
{
var options = new WordProcessingConvertOptions(); // Настройте параметры преобразования DOCX
converter.Convert(outputFilePath, options);
}
Этот фрагмент кода демонстрирует загрузку файла STL и его преобразование с помощью Converter
класс. WordProcessingConvertOptions
позволяет настраивать выходной файл DOCX.
Советы по устранению неполадок
- Убедитесь, что пути заданы правильно, чтобы избежать ошибок «файл не найден».
- Убедитесь, что у вас есть разрешения на чтение/запись в указанных каталогах.
Практические применения
Понимание того, как можно применять эту функцию преобразования, повысит ее полезность:
- Техническая документация: Преобразование файлов STL в редактируемый текст для проектной документации.
- Создание образовательного контента: Преобразуйте данные 3D-моделей в учебные материалы или презентации.
- Деловая отчетность: Интеграция отчетов по 3D-проектированию со стандартными деловыми документами.
GroupDocs.Conversion можно интегрировать с другими системами .NET, такими как ASP.NET и Xamarin, что расширяет его универсальность на различных платформах.
Соображения производительности
Оптимизация производительности имеет решающее значение при конвертации файлов:
- Управление ресурсами: Контролируйте системные ресурсы, чтобы предотвратить возникновение узких мест во время преобразования.
- Использование памяти: Эффективно управляйте памятью, правильно размещая объекты в коде.
- Пакетная обработка: При больших объемах рассмотрите возможность обработки файлов пакетами, чтобы поддерживать оптимальную производительность.
Заключение
Теперь вы освоили преобразование файлов STL в формат DOCX с помощью GroupDocs.Conversion для .NET. С помощью этого мощного инструмента вы можете оптимизировать рабочие процессы и улучшить взаимодействие документов в различных секторах. В качестве следующих шагов изучите дополнительные форматы файлов, поддерживаемые GroupDocs.Conversion, или интегрируйте его с другими приложениями, чтобы расширить его полезность.
Раздел часто задаваемых вопросов
В1: Могу ли я конвертировать файлы STL в другие форматы с помощью GroupDocs.Conversion? A1: Да! GroupDocs.Conversion поддерживает широкий спектр форматов документов помимо DOCX.
В2: Каковы системные требования для запуска GroupDocs.Conversion на моем компьютере? A2: Для оптимальной производительности требуется .NET Framework 4.5 или более поздняя версия, а также достаточный объем памяти и ресурсов ЦП.
В3: Есть ли ограничение на размер файла при конвертации документов? A3: Хотя GroupDocs.Conversion поддерживает большие файлы, производительность может зависеть от возможностей системы.
В4: Как обрабатывать ошибки конвертации в моем приложении?
A4: Реализуйте обработку исключений вокруг Convert
метод изящного управления любыми возникающими проблемами.
В5: Можно ли использовать GroupDocs.Conversion для пакетной обработки документов? A5: Да, вы можете выполнить цикл по нескольким файлам и применить преобразования за один проход, используя методы программирования .NET.
Ресурсы
- Документация: GroupDocs.Conversion.NET Документация
- Ссылка на API: Ссылка на API GroupDocs
- Скачать: Скачать GroupDocs.Conversion
- Покупка: Купить GroupDocs.Conversion
- Бесплатная пробная версия: Попробуйте бесплатно
- Временная лицензия: Получить временную лицензию
- Поддерживать: Форум GroupDocs
Мы надеемся, что это руководство поможет вам использовать GroupDocs.Conversion для ваших нужд по конвертации файлов. Удачного кодирования!